Highlights
Are people in Mansfield older or younger than people in Abington?
- The Median Age in Mansfield is 2.2 years older than in Abington.

Are housing costs cheaper in Mansfield or Abington?
- Mansfield housing costs are 11.2% more expensive than Abington hous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Mansfield or Abington?
- The average commute for residents of Mansfield is 2.3 minutes longer than it is for residents of Abington.

Things to do in Mansfield?
Mansfield, Massachusetts is known for its charming colonial-style architecture and historic downtown area. The town offers a unique mix of rural charm and modern conveniences with convenient shopping centers located close by as well as museums, entertainment venues and attractions such as the Mansfield Drive-In Theater.
